Natural Sciences students must take units totaling 60 credits in each programme year, usually comprising five blocks of 12 credits each, although some final year projects are worth 18 or 24 credits. Students must choose a major subject stream to follow and must take two blocks of units in this major subject each year. For further information on the structure of the programme, please see the Natural Sciences Course Guide. |
